Event Manager Resume Example

This resume was created for a client interested in furthering her career in Event Planning. She is fairly new to the working world and does not have much experience.

For this reason, we attempted to highlight the positive traits and qualities that she does possess by beginning the resume with an introductory paragraph and Core Competencies section.

For their brief employment history, internships were included to beef up the resume and key points were written in bold font so that they stand out to prospective employers.

The focus of this section was to truly delve into how the client would contribute to any company and demonstrate that, while fairly new to the field, they have been successful at each step in their career progression.

Education background was included to complete the resume so that employers would see that the candidate is well educated and capable of high level work.

Event Manager Resume Experience Statements

  • Promoted to Sales Manager role due to excellent performance and placed in charge of selling and planning events.
  • Build corporate and social client base through nurturing incoming leads and in-person/online outbound sales reach-out.
  • Oversee budgets ranging from $50,000 to $200,000.
  • Coordinate menu development, room selection and layout, event timeline and planning, style, decor and outside vendors for a wide range of events.
  • Develop marketing plans through elaborate event showcases and social media campaigns.
  • Secure deposits and verify that final payments are received.
  • Generate weekly sales analysis for City Club Sales Department.
  • Manage all integral event requirements, including parking, entertainment, decorations and audio/visual components.
  • Foster positive rapport with Corporate and Social Clients via timely issue resolution and continuous communication.
